Vertikální zahrady ve střední Evropě

Vrbas, Filip January 2015 (has links)
The topic of this thesis is about the possibility of applying vertical gardens in middle of Europe. First time, there was made methodics to evaluation of vertical gardens. After it, there were evaluated eight objects in middle of Europe and four objects in Paris. The condition was descpribed. Special attention was placed on plants. The second part of this thesis is about a practical demonstration of experimental vertical garden with three growing systems. There were used 25 species of plants and three types of substrates. The vitality, size and phenophases were evaluated.

Přesnost zaměření fasády historického objektu metody, možnosti, podmínky / Accuracy of the facade of the historic building - methods, possibilities, conditions

DVOŘÁKOVÁ, Jitka January 2014 (has links)
This thesis deals with methods of surveying the facade of the historic building. The introductory section is a brief history of measurement and guidelines, as well as various methods are described from oldest to youngest, including their accuracy in targeting the facade. In more detail, a method for scanning and photogrammetry, which is currently the youngest methods used in surveying facades. In conclusion, the evaluation methods in terms of accuracy and usability. The aim is to describe and evaluace different methods of surveying from history to the present, including the necessary instruments and their accuracy.

Polyfunkční dům / Polyfunctional building

Michna, Patrik January 2017 (has links)
The assignment of my diploma thesis was to design a polyfunctional building. Function of the building is based on the requirements of the Land Use Plan Brno, cadastral zone Židenice. The aim of the design was to improve the quality of public space in the area by creating parks, urban parterre with services, parking and by bringing missing features to the area. The building is located in the centre of the plot. The main facade is oriented to the main street. Design creates new parking on the ground and in the underground garage. On the first floor are rentable spaces for commerce and services. At 2nd and 3rd floor are open space offices with the possibility of spatial variability solutions. Architectural expression of the building is simple, consisting as a compact mass with parterre subsided, useful in terms of energetical sustainability. The facade of the building is made as a combination of a transparent double skin facade and opaque ventilated facade with fibre cement panels. Structural system is a precast concrete frame with a cast-in-place reinforced concrete shear core. Foundation is made as a reinforced concrete pads and strips. Ceiling is made of a precast prestressed hollow core slabs.

Vinařství / Winegrowing

Kulenda, Jan January 2018 (has links)
The diploma thesis subject is the proposal of the winery with a focus on the production of quality wine with the attribute and with a capacity of 30 000 bottles per year. The winery provides the possibility of accommodation in 6 units with a total capacity of 14 people with extension for meals. The viticulture is situated in the outskirts of Popice. The winery consists of three first floor detached buildings of a broken elongated shape, SO 01, SO 02 and SO 03, the first one is partially sub-basement. The SO 01 has wine production character in the cellar, the first floor provides background for employees, creates administrative spaces and offers catering for the public. Objects SO 02 and SO 03 serve to accommodate guests, the first one taking into account barrier-free use. Construction system is brick wall, in first floor of ceramic blocks and the cellar from blocks of lost formwork filled with concrete. The façade consists of an ETICS thermal insulation composite system and a ventilated façade. Cellar ceiling structures are solved with monolithic reinforced concrete slabs. The objects are roofed with gable and shad roofs with titan-zinc roof covering and bearing structure made of glued lamellar wood trusses.
